We want them to take faith not as a set of commands and prohibitions, but as a living relationship with God.&#8221;<\/h2>\n<h2>It is complemented by animator Ema Kardo\u0161ov\u00e1: &#8220;Various meetings and events for children and youth are intended for this purpose. To help them as a community find their spiritual vocation, to bring them closer to God constantly.&#8221;<\/h2>\n<p><strong>ACTIVE CHRISTIAN<\/strong><\/p>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">However, according to Lucie Holtanov\u00e1, the essence of the Christian life often escapes us. &#8220;An active Christian should not have his faith just as a point on a list to be fulfilled in thirty minutes but should live his faith throughout his life. Belief in God should be our lifestyle.&#8221; Because of a very limited definition of faith, we will also give in to a distorted judgment of what it means to be an active Christian.<\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">&#8220;Let&#8217;s imagine a person who sweeps away all Christian events,&#8221; thinks Lucia. &#8220;However, for me, he is a person actively using the talents and potential that he received from God, for his praise. And this can be done even without holding the record for the number of attended events.&#8221;<\/h2>\n<p><strong>SPREADING THE JOY<\/strong><\/p>\n<h2>But where does the Christian in us go when we change the festive Sunday clothing to work clothes? After all, no matter what our calling is, we will reach our spiritual goal if we go into everything with joy stemming from faith in God. &#8220;Spreading Christian joy is the most important thing. To bring it to everyday situations at school, at work, in the family, in the community,&#8221; states Lucia.<\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\"><span style=\"font-size: 1.2em; background-color: transparent;\">To achieve a big goal, we like to look for big solutions. So we may overlook something plain and simple with a wave of the hand. The animator Ema Kardo\u0161ov\u00e1 also draws attention to this. &#8220;Helping others, forgiving them, and loving them &#8211; for me, these virtues mean the most important thing in the vocation of a Christian.&#8221;<\/span><\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\"><strong>THANKS TO WHO WE ARE IN THE WORLD<\/strong><\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">However, in the hustle and bustle of our fast-paced lives, we forget spirituality very quickly. Problems of all kinds begin to demand our attention as soon as we turn on our phone notifications after Mass. &#8220;Sometimes we are so busy with worldly duties that we don&#8217;t even have time for a short prayer,&#8221; thinks Ema.<\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">&#8220;That&#8217;s when you have to realize, thanks to whom we are in this world, thanks to whom we woke up this morning. This is a reason for thanksgiving, to, for example, go to holy confession, to holy mass, so that we constantly return to life with God.&#8221;<\/h2>\n<p><strong>TO GIVE AND RECEIVE<\/strong><\/p>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">Lucia also offers her advice, explaining how they fit in with this role in their association. &#8220;To be able to live our faith fully even during everyday worries, we need not only to give but also to receive. In the Marian Youth Association, there is an opportunity for both &#8211; weekly meetings, spiritual renewals, camps, and animation courses are an opportunity to self-recharge.&#8221; He therefore recommends learning to strengthen and realize your faith through a suitable Christian community.<\/h2>\n<div class=\"special-container-grey\">\n<p><strong>Spiritual anchors<\/strong><\/p>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">When the waves of ambition and worry begin to carry us too far, spiritual anchors help us. There are many ways to remember the forgotten, to revive the dying flame in our hearts. &#8220;It is good if we reserve at least some time of the day that we dedicate only to God. When we are in daily contact with him, it will be harder for us to forget him,&#8221; advises Lucie Holtanova, animator of the Marian Youth Association.<\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">In addition to the personal relationship with God, he also draws attention to the fact that man is a social creature. &#8220;Therefore, we encourage young people not to live their faith alone, but in a community that can be a big spiritual family for them.&#8221;<\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">Other people&#8217;s works can also be a spiritual anchor for us. &#8220;A beautiful, more modern way of evangelization is praise. Thanks to them, many people were converted or came into a closer relationship with the Lord,&#8221; perceives animator Ema Kardo\u0161ov\u00e1.<\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">However, praise does not have to belong only to temples. They can also accompany us on the way to school, to work, or after a tiring day on the way home, when we thank God for him with a prayer of praise.<\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">And finally, the great power of being a Christian at every moment is also hidden within ourselves. Often it is enough to just reach for it &#8211; for example by offering a helping hand. &#8220;We have to take courage, come out of our shell, and act,&#8221; encourages Lucia.<\/h2>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: justify;\">You don&#8217;t even need to do anything noisy or big. &#8220;It is enough if we try to live our lives in such a way that God&#8217;s light is visible in us,&#8221; says Ema in conclusion. &#8220;When we are not ashamed to, for example, bless ourselves in public. Maybe those around you won&#8217;t understand, maybe they&#8217;ll laugh, but maybe they&#8217;ll ask. And that, too, is the possibility of living true faith and evangelization.&#8221;?<\/h2>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>The life of a Christian can appear as an effort to merge two incompatible worlds.
